Pran

પ્રાણ

Life force, breath

Pran is derived from the Sanskrit word 'Prana', which refers to the vital life force or breath that sustains all living beings. In Vedic philosophy, it is considered the cosmic energy that animates the physical body, holding deep spiritual and cultural significance in Indian traditions.
